In the poignant drama Times of Joy and Sorrow, released in 1957, the audience is drawn into the isolated world of a dedicated lighthouse keeper and his devoted wife, who navigate the tumultuous waters of both nature and their personal lives. Set against the backdrop of a rugged coastline, the film beautifully captures the essence of love, perseverance, and the emotional toll of solitude. As the couple faces the relentless forces of nature, their relationship is tested by the challenges of isolation and the weight of their responsibilities, creating a gripping narrative that resonates with anyone who has grappled with the dualities of happiness and hardship.
